General Description
As a Mechanical Design Expert, you will play a crucial role in the successful design and engineering of the Mechanical Balance of Plant (MBoP) systems and equipment for Hydro Power Projects. Your responsibilities will encompass a wide range of tasks, starting from turbine auxiliaries, and hydraulic components of the governor to ensuring compliance with standards and regulations.
JOB RESPONSIBILITIES AND TASKS
Mechanical Design and Engineering:
Both basic and detailed engineering of Mechanical auxiliary systems for Hydro Power Projects. Prepare Design Memorandums, Schematics, and Calculations ensuring accuracy and efficiency.
Proficiency in various Mechanical Balance of Plant (MBoP) packages, including Cooling Water Systems, Drainage and Dewatering Systems, Compressed Air Systems, Fire Fighting Systems, HVAC Systems, and Oil Pumping Unit (OPU) Systems ensuring alignment with overall technical project requirements.
Engineering Excellence: Good technical knowledge of Mechanical Systems. Clarify and communicate design details with customers and cross-functional teams, addressing any queries or concerns. Excellent equipment sizing and selection skills. Utilize engineering software and tools like AutoCAD and other equipment sizing tools and ensure a "first-time-right" approach.
Customer Focus: Prioritize customer satisfaction and maintain a strong focus on quality.
Cross-functional and supplier collaboration: Interface with cross-functional teams including procurement, quality control, and erection & commissioning to ensure seamless integration of engineering activities within defined time limits and to expedite project progress.
Timely Delivery: Monitor and enforce adherence to design schedules, ensuring on-time delivery (OTD) of engineering components.
Adherence to standards and Quality Assurance: Ensure that the design and engineering of packages meet guaranteed and contractual requirements while adhering to relevant industry standards, regulations, policies, and procedures.
